RESOLVED, by the Board of Supervisors of the County of San Mateo, State of California, that

WHEREAS, on August 5, 2008 the Board of Supervisors approved a Resolution (Resolution No 069623) to submit a grant application in the amount of not to exceed $2,500,000 to the California Office of Homeland Security and to execute the grant and any other documents required by and for the program as described.

 

WHEREAS, the California Office of Homeland Security has now distributed additional funding to the Sheriff’s Office of Emergency Services (OES) in the amount of $116,386 to enhance and/or supplement the capabilities of local first responders

 

WHEREAS, OES will serve as the administrator for the grant award received in the amount of TWO MILLION SIX HUNDRED SIXTEEN THOUSAND THREE HUNDRED EIGHTY SIX DOLLARS AND NO CENTS ($2,616,386) through the State of California from the Department of Homeland Security (DHS) to enhance the capabilities of local first responders;

WHEREAS, this grant award is a no match grant through the U.S. Department of Homeland Security (DHS);

WHEREAS, this additional grant funding will be used to enhance the following projects: Interoperability Communications, Information Sharing, Pharmaceuticals and Supplies, Public Notification System, Training and Exercising for First Responders, and Citizen Preparedness.

NOW, THEREFORE, IT IS HEREBY DETERMINED AND ORDERED that the Board of Supervisors authorizes the Sheriff, in his capacity as OES Area Coordinator, to apply for and accept the additional grant funding.

IT IS FURTHER ORDERED; that the Sheriff in his capacity as OES Area Coordinator or his designees execute the grant and any related documents.
